28 WADE PARK AVENUE is a midsized detached house of 115m², built sometime between 1983 and 1990. It was last sold for £292,000 in November 2020, which was around 7% below the average November 2020 detached price in the South Kesteven local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was November 2012,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was B.

28 WADE PARK AVENUE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the South Kesteven local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The three 28 WADE PARK AVENUE sales between November 2007 and November 2020 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the March 2013 sale was for 5%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 5% above the HPI over time, until the November 2020 sale, where it falls to 7%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 7% below the HPI.
